2SC5200N Bipolar Transistor

Characteristics of 2SC5200N Transistor

  • Type: NPN
  • Collector-Emitter Voltage, max: 230 V
  • Collector-Base Voltage, max: 230 V
  • Emitter-Base Voltage, max: 5 V
  • Collector Current − Continuous, max: 15 A
  • Collector Dissipation: 100 W
  • DC Current Gain (hfe): 55 to 160
  • Transition Frequency, min: 30 MHz
  • Operating and Storage Junction Temperature Range: -55 to +150 °C
  • Package: TO-3P
  • Electrically Similar to the Popular 2SC5200 transistor

Classification of hFE

The 2SC5200N transistor can have a current gain of 55 to 160. The gain of the 2SC5200 will be in the range from 55 to 160, for the 2SC5200O it will be in the range from 80 to 160, for the 2SC5200R it will be in the range from 55 to 100.

Marking

Sometimes the "2S" prefix is not marked on the package - the 2SC5200N might only be marked "C5200N".

Complementary PNP transistor

The complementary PNP transistor to the 2SC5200N is the 2SA1943N.

Replacement and Equivalent for 2SC5200N transistor

You can replace the 2SC5200N with the 2SC3320, 2SC5242, 2SC5358, 2SC6011A, 2SC6011A-O, 2SC6011A-P, 2SC6011A-Y, 2SD1313, FJA4313, FJL4315, KTC5200, KTC5200A, KTC5242, KTC5242A, MJW3281A or MJW3281AG.
